Emgrand S has a minimum ground clearance of 167mm. Below is an introduction to related information about minimum ground clearance: 1. Vehicle minimum ground clearance: The minimum ground clearance of a vehicle refers to the smallest height between the chassis and the ground when the vehicle is at maximum load. 2. Vehicle chassis: The vehicle chassis refers to the entire bottom part of the vehicle, which supports the whole vehicle. When driving, owners should pay attention to the height of the road surface to determine whether their vehicle can pass. If it cannot pass, they should choose another route and must not force their way through, as this can damage the vehicle's chassis.
Last time I accompanied a friend to the 4S store to test drive the Emgrand S, I specifically measured it. The ground clearance when unloaded is about 17 cm, which is roughly the height of a regular smartphone placed vertically. This car is positioned as an urban crossover, taller than a regular sedan but shorter than an SUV. The salesperson said the ground clearance would drop to around 13 cm when fully loaded, so you need to be extra careful with speed bumps and stones when driving on rough roads with a full load. By the way, a reminder for owners who want to install protective plates: make sure to calculate the thickness properly, or it might actually affect the vehicle's ground clearance.
